Essential Tools for Mercedes Interior Trim Repair

auto repair workshop

When taking on a Mercedes interior trim repair project, having the right tools is essential for achieving professional results and ensuring a precise fit. This includes a variety of specialized equipment designed to handle the intricate details of Mercedes vehicles.

Some must-have tools for any Mercedes interior trim repair include a set of high-quality impact drivers and torx screwdrivers, as these models are commonly used in Mercedes assembly. A precision cut knife is also invaluable for trimming and shaping new or repaired trim pieces. For more complex repairs involving panel replacement or frame straightening after a fender bender, an air compressor and a set of metal working tools will be required to ensure the job is done correctly.

Step-by-Step Preparation and Safety Measures

auto repair workshop

Before tackling any Mercedes interior trim repair project, thorough preparation is key. Begin by gathering all necessary tools and materials, ensuring they are specific to your car model and repair task. This includes anything from replacement parts like door panels or dashboards to specialized equipment such as heat guns for plastic welding, sandpaper for smoothing edges, and applicators for adhesive. Once you have everything in place, create a clean and organized workspace. Remove any loose items from the interior, vacuum thoroughly, and wipe down surfaces with a mild cleaning agent to ensure no debris or contaminants remain that could affect the repair process.

Safety is paramount during Mercedes interior trim repairs. Always prioritize personal protective equipment (PPE), including gloves, safety glasses, and a respirator mask to protect against fumes and debris. Ensure proper ventilation in your work area by opening windows or using an exhaust fan. Be cautious when handling chemicals like adhesives and solvents, following manufacturer guidelines for application and storage. Moreover, be mindful of sharp edges and high-temperature tools to avoid burns or cuts during the repair process.
